Are people in Lenoir City older or younger than people in Buffalo?
- The Median Age in Lenoir City is 3.9 years younger than in Buffalo.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lenoir City or Buffalo?
- Lenoir City housing costs are 1.2% more expensive than Buffalo hous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lenoir City or Buffalo?
- The average commute for residents of Lenoir City is 7.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Buffalo.

Things to do in Buffalo?
Situated within the Minneapolis-Saint Paul metro area lies Buffalo -- a small city offering access to big city amenities along with beautiful scenery featuring country parks, ample green space and plenty of bike trails around one of Minnesota’s larger lakes.
